Here’s what our employees have to say about working at JFrog:
- "I wanted to work in a company that takes technology forward."
- "As a developer, seeing your products on the biggest Tech event stages twice a year is WOW."
- "For developers who work here, they have everything that they can wish for to learn and develop new things, including AI and cyber."
What you’ll be doing as an Architect:
- Define architectural approaches and detailed technical Engineering specifications
- Develop architectural POCs, research technical innovations and evaluate new technologies
- Provide architectural oversight and guidance to Engineering teams, negotiate trade-offs and drive issues to closure
- Work with Product Management to understand business requirements and market trends
- Review code and perform acceptance testing to ensure quality and consistency with architectural vision
- Help to steer the architectural and Engineering priorities of the company
What you bring on to the table:
- 12+ years of industry experience preferably in tech heavy product companies
- 5+ years of experience with software architecture and design process, working on large-scale, complex and high-performance distributed systems
- 5+ years of hands-on programming experience in languages such as Java, Go, JavaScript (Node)
- 2+ years of hands-on technical leadership in a Principal Engineer or Technical Lead role
- 2+ years of hands-on experience in B2B systems and design of external APIs
- Excellent problem solving skills and strong sense of ownership and track record of quality work
- Ability to to work both independently and as an equal peer when working with Engineering